Weekend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Pro
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ak in a bathroom | Yes | No | You can likely fix the leak yourself and save money on labor costs. |
| Large amount of standing water in a basement | No | Yes | Extraction equipment and expertise are required to safely and efficiently remove the water. |
| Hidden water damage behind walls or under floors | No | Yes | Our team has the specialized equipment and training to detect and remove hidden water damage. |
| Mold growth in a crawl space | No | Yes | Mold remediation needs specialized equipment and training to ensure the area is safe and healthy. |
| Water damage from a natural disaster | No | Yes | Our team has the expertise and equipment to handle large-scale water removal and restoration projects. |

Weekend Water Removal Cost in Syracuse, UT
The cost of water removal in Syracuse, UT, varies based on the severity and size of the affected area. Pr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age. Our team will work with you to develop a customized plan and provide a free estimate for your water removal service.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and amount of standing water |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area and type of equipment required |
| Sanitizing and Cleaning | $300 – $1,000 | Type of surfaces and materials affected |
| Final Inspection and Touch-ups |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area and type of repairs required |

Common Questions About Weekend Water Removal
How long does water removal take?
Water removal times vary depending on the size of the affected area and the amount of standing water. Our team works efficiently to get the job done quickly but it’s essential to allow enough time for drying and dehumidification. Typically, water removal takes 3-5 days, but it can take longer for more extensive damage.
Will my insurance cover water removal costs?
Yes, most insurance policies cover water removal costs, but it’s essential to review your policy and contact your insurance company to confirm. We’ll work with you and your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process and reduce your out-of-pocket expenses.
Can I try to remove water myself?
No, it’s not recommended to try to remove water yourself, especially if you’re dealing with a large amount of standing water or hidden damage. Our team has the specialized equipment and training to safely and efficiently remove water and prevent further damage.
How do I prevent water damage in the future?
Preventing water damage needs regular maintenance and inspections. Check your pipes and appliances regularly to ensure they’re functioning properly. Also, keep an eye out for signs of water intrusion, such as musty odors or visible stains.
